Who is Lota Chukwu?

Lota Chukwu Biography
Lota Chukwu Biography

Lota Chukwu is a Nigerian actress, writer, and television personality best known for playing Kiki in the popular Nollywood television series Jenifa’s Diary created by Funke Akindele.

Her full name is Ugwu Lotachukwu Jacinta Obianuju Amelia, and she belongs to the Igbo ethnic group of southeastern Nigeria.

Lota Chukwu Early Life and Background

The Lota Chukwu biography begins in southeastern Nigeria.

She was born on 29 November 1989 in Nsukka, Enugu State, Nigeria. Although she was born in Enugu State, she spent a large part of her childhood growing up in Benin City, Edo State.

Lota Chukwu is the youngest of four children in her family. Growing up in a household with siblings shaped her personality and social outlook.

Lota Chukwu Education

Education occupies an important place in the Lota Chukwu biography.

She attended the University of Benin (UNIBEN) where she studied Agricultural Economics and Extension Services.

Although her university degree was outside the performing arts, Lota later pursued professional training at the Royal Arts Academy in Lagos, a well-known acting institution founded by Nollywood filmmaker Emem Isong.

Her training helped refine her acting abilities and prepared her for professional roles in Nollywood.

Lota Chukwu Career

The acting career described in the Lota Chukwu biography developed gradually.

Before becoming widely known, she worked as a model and also participated in the Most Beautiful Girl in Nigeria (MBGN) pageant in 2011, representing Yobe State.

Although she did not win the competition, the experience exposed her to the entertainment industry and increased her confidence in front of cameras.

She began appearing in film and television projects around 2011, gradually building experience within Nollywood.

Breakthrough Role – Jenifa’s Diary

The turning point in the Lota Chukwu biography came when she joined the cast of Jenifa’s Diary, a popular Nigerian television comedy series created by Funke Akindele.

In the series, Lota Chukwu played Kiki, a fashionable and outspoken friend of the lead character Jenifa.

The character quickly became one of the most memorable personalities in the show. Through this role, the Lota Chukwu biography gained national recognition and introduced her to millions of viewers across Nigeria and beyond.

Lota Chukwu Movies and TV Shows

The Lota Chukwu biography includes appearances in several Nollywood films and television productions.

Some of the notable movies and television shows associated with Lota Chukwu include:

  • Jenifa’s Diary
  • The Arbitration
  • Falling
  • Fine Girl
  • The Royal Hibiscus Hotel
  • Dognapped
  • Ajoche
  • Enakhe
